Footy First - Episode 24 - September 3, 2022

In this week's show, Nick McVicar and York United Keeper Niko Giantsopoulos discuss the League 1 Ontario final this weekend and how important League 1 Canada has been this season for the growth of soccer in Canada. They are then joined by former CPL President and current Managing Director of Pacific FC Paul Beirne to discuss the growth of the league and his new role. The boys then discuss the recent hiring of Amy Walsh by CF Montreal and what it could mean for the growth of the sports among women. They finish off with their predictions.
